Warning Signs You Need Broken Pipe Water Damage Restoration

Catching the signs of broken pipe water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ent more extensive damage. Don’t ignore these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ent, unpleasant odor in your home can be a sign of moisture buildup or mold growth. Don’t wait, investigate the source and address the issue quickly.

Water Stains or Warping on Walls or Ceiling

Water damage can cause unsightly stains or warping on walls and ceilings.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to more extensive damage if left unchecked.

Discolored or Swollen Flooring

Water damage can cause flooring to become discolored or swollen. Don’t wait, address the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ks in your pipes can be a sign of a larger issue.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s down the line.

Increased Water Bills

An unexpected increase in your water bills can be a sign of hidden leaks or water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, investigate and address the issue quickly.

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ew

Visible signs of mold or mildew can be a sign of water damage or poor ventilation. Don’t ignore these signs, address the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.

Broken Pipe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Burst pipe in a small area (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Yes No DIY is fine for small areas, but be sure to follow safety guidelines and take necessary precautions.
Significant water damage (more than 100 sq. Ft.) No Yes For larger areas, it’s best to call a professional to ensure thorough drying, cleaning, and restoration.
Pipe leak causing mold growth No Yes Mold growth needs specialized equipment and techniques to safely remove and prevent future growth.
Water damage affecting multiple floors or rooms No Yes For extensive damage, it’s best to call a professional to ensure a thorough and efficient restoration process.
Unknown source of water damage No Yes A professional can help identify the source of the damage and recommend the best course of action.
Water damage in a sensitive or high-value area (e.g., kitchen, bathroom) No Yes For sensitive or high-value areas, it’s best to call a professional to ensure thorough cleaning, sanitizing, and restoration.

While DIY might seem like a cost-effective option for small areas, it’s essential to remember that water damage can quickly become a larger issue if not addressed quickly and properly. For significant water damage, it’s always best to call a professional to ensure a thorough and efficient restoration process.

Broken Pipe Water Damage Restoration Cost in Otsego, MN

The cost of Broken Pipe Water Damage Restoration in Otsego, MN can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average costs and may not reflect your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al and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water extracted
Pipe Repair or Repl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Materials used, complexity of repair
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Equipment used, size of affected area
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Materials used, size of affected area
Restoration and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Materials used, complexity of repair

How do I prevent Broken Pipe Water Damage?

Preventing Broken Pipe Water Dam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Be sure to check your pipes for signs of damage or wear, and consider installing freeze-proof faucets or frost-proof spigots in areas prone to freezing temperatures. Also, keep your home’s temperature above 55°F during extremely cold weather.
